MAIN EPISODE: It's a triple feature movie marathon as Diego returns to the cinematic roundtable to discuss Robert Rodriguez's film trilogy, The Mexico Trilogy.
Listen as we discuss the films: El Mariachi, Desperado, and Once Upon a Time in Mexico. A story surrounding a musician who falling into the wrong circumstances as the cartel of Mexico is hunting down a man who also matches the Mariachi's description: a man dressed in black and white. The story unravels from there as it becomes personal as El Mariachi loses the people close to him.
